Baked Zucchini and Tomato Fan Casserole

🧾 Ingredients & Prep Guide

IngredientQuantity
Young zucchini3, sliced into fan-like strips
Tomatoes3–4, thinly sliced
Grated cheese200 g (7 oz) – mozzarella or cheddar
Sour cream7 tablespoons
Garlic2 cloves, finely chopped
Smoked paprikaTo taste
SaltTo taste

👩‍🍳 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 200°C (390°F).
  2. Wash the zucchini and slice into finger-width strips, keeping the base intact to form a fan shape. Slice tomatoes into thin rounds.
  3. Arrange zucchini slices in a baking dish. Nestle tomato slices between the zucchini “fingers.”
  4. Season lightly with salt and smoked paprika.
  5. In a small bowl, mix sour cream with chopped garlic until smooth.
  6. Spoon the garlic cream evenly over the vegetables, covering both zucchini and tomatoes.
  7. Generously sprinkle grated cheese over the top.
  8. Bake for 20–25 minutes until the cheese is melted, bubbly, and golden brown.
  9. Let cool slightly before serving warm.

🥗 Cooking Tips & Nutritional Highlights

  • Slice zucchini carefully to keep the base intact for a fan-like presentation.
  • Mix cheese varieties for deeper flavor – try gouda, emmental, or parmesan.
  • Substitute sour cream with Greek yogurt for a lighter version.
  • Zucchini is low in calories and high in fiber and vitamins.
  • Tomatoes provide antioxidants like lycopene, which support heart health.
  • Cheese adds protein and calcium for bone strength.
